Niger - Import of Colouring Matter of Vegetable or Animal Origin

Since 2014, Niger Import of Colouring Matter of Vegetable or Animal Origin was up 6.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 117 comparing other countries in Import of Colouring Matter of Vegetable or Animal Origin with $65,205.67. Niger is overtaken by Fiji, which was ranked number 116 at $76,488.58 and is followed by Cabo Verde with $60,422.49. United States ranked the highest with $200,864,229.23 in 2019, that is +1.4% compared to 2018. Japan, Germany and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bahrain recorded the best 5 years average growth at +141.1% per year, while Greenland recorded the worst performance at -61.2% per year.
